The Good
- Martingale Strategy: This betting system involves doubling your bet after each loss, aiming to recover previous losses. It can be effective in the short term, especially in games with low minimum bets.
- Low House Edge: European roulette has a house edge of just 2.7% compared to American roulette, which has a house edge of 5.26%, making it a better choice for strategic play.
- Variety of Bets: Players can choose from different types of bets (inside vs. outside) based on their risk appetite, allowing for tailored strategies.
The Bad
- Wagering Requirements: Many casinos impose wagering requirements on bonuses, often around 35x. This can make it challenging to realize profits from roulette bonuses.
- Bankroll Management: Strategies like Martingale can quickly deplete your bankroll if you hit a losing streak. A $1 bet can escalate to $128 after just 7 losses.
- Emotional Decision-Making: Players often chase losses, leading to poor decisions that can further increase their losses.
The Ugly
- False Promises: Many strategies are marketed as foolproof, which is misleading. Roulette is inherently random, and no strategy can change that.
- Risk of Addiction: The thrill of potential wins may lead to excessive gambling, making it vital for players to set limits and stay disciplined.
